Output 53c63c372351442254ec5a5258d192cc1a9a58bd7f2082fc4e7e2a8480679ef4:1

value
23000
script pubkey
OP_0 OP_PUSHBYTES_20 80fa29bfd73ee9060687c641640b8d494e014c3d
address
bc1qsrazn07h8m5svp58ceqkgzudf98qznpa0e26dx
transaction
53c63c372351442254ec5a5258d192cc1a9a58bd7f2082fc4e7e2a8480679ef4
spent
true